Narayana Murthy, born on August 20, 1946, is the co-founder of Infosys, which he established in 1981 with an initial capital of Rs. 10,000 from his wife. He served as CEO until 2002 and later as chairman until 2011, receiving numerous awards for his contributions, including the Padma Shri and Padma Vibhushan. Infosys became the first Indian company to be listed on NASDAQ and has developed multiple software centers across India.
